2/5-6 (SA): Las Virgenes, Thunder Rd, Strub; San Antonio
 
3rd (1:33) Las Virgenes S. (G1)

1 Mile (Sand) | Fillies | 3 Year Olds | Stakes | Purse: $250,000

1 Plum Pretty M. Garcia 117 Lbs B. Baffert - L
2 Bluegrass Chatter G. Gomez 117 Lbs J. Hollendorfer - L
3 Tiz the Route B. Blanc 117 Lbs J. Herrick - L
4 California Nectar P. Valenzuela 117 Lbs D. O'Neill - L
5 May Day Rose R. Bejarano 119 Lbs B. Baffert - L
6 Turbulent Descent D. Flores 122 Lbs M. Puype - L
7 Zazu J. Rosario 117 Lbs J. Sadler - L



8th (4:10) Thunder Road H. (G3)

1 Mile (Turf) | Open | 4 Year Olds And Up | Handicap | Purse: $100,000

1 Blue Chagall (FR) G. Gomez 118 Lbs J. Canani - L
2 Fluke (BRZ) J. Talamo 120 Lbs H. Ascanio - L
3 Dakota Phone J. Rosario 120 Lbs J. Hollendorfer - L
4 Proudinsky (GER) P. Valenzuela 120 Lbs H. Ascanio - L
5 Meteore A. Quinonez 116 Lbs R. Mandella - L
6 Jazzman's Dance K. Stra 108 Lbs J. Davidson - L
7 Skyrush (ARG) M. Pedroza 116 Lbs D. Vienna - L
8 Colgan's Chip B. Blanc 116 Lbs J. Sahadi - L
9 Victor's Cry V. Espinoza 122 Lbs E. Harty - L



9th (4:42) Strub S. (G2)

1 1/8 Miles (Sand) | Open | 4 Year Olds | Stakes | Purse: $200,000

1 Honour the Deputy G. Gomez 118 Lbs J. Hollendorfer - L
2 Indian Firewater M. Smith 123 Lbs B. Baffert - L
3 Twirling Candy J. Rosario 123 Lbs J. Sadler - L
4 Tweebster R. Bejarano 118 Lbs B. Baffert - L
5 Paris Vegas B. Blanc 118 Lbs L. Powell - L
6 Make Music for Me C. Sutherland 118 Lbs A. Barba - L
7 Do It All P. Valenzuela 118 Lbs E. Harty - L
8 Oilisblackgold V. Espinoza 118 Lbs C. Dollase - L

I wonder where Twirling Candy would have finished had he run in the Donn Handicap today. Visually, he still seems to be a bit of a run-off type going two turns and I don't think he would have enjoyed being placed somewhere between Square Eddie/Morning Line and Rule/I Want Revenge.

Nonetheless, a very powerful performance in what amounted to a second level allowance race based on the rest of the field (unless you're ready to call Indian Firewater a real Grade 2 horse).
